the dual lawyer system in the uk: the british legal system, derived from its long judicial tradition, emphasizes the importance of case law and judicial interpretation. this legal system originated in the 12th and 13th centuries, when professional lawyers began to appear in britain, divided into narratores and attorneys. this dualistic lawyer system is still widely used today, forming a structure of barristers and solicitors.

germany's civil law system: germany's legal system is centered on the civil law system, which reflects its unique social and cultural characteristics. this system focuses on concepts such as civil law, civil rights and social responsibilities, and emphasizes the coordination of interpersonal relationships and social obligations. germany's civil law system has also been continuously improved and adjusted with the development of the times, forming a complete legal norm and judicial system.

france's complex legal system: the french legal system is more complex due to its long history. it combines the legal traditions of the french empire and is inspired by the legal systems of other european countries. the complexity of the legal system reflects the diversity and pluralism of french society and culture. the french legal system has been continuously developed in practice, forming a unique judicial mechanism and legal system.

machine translation facilitates cross-language communication: with the continuous development of artificial intelligence technology, machine translation, as an automation technology, has provided new possibilities for cross-language communication. machine translation can automatically convert texts between different languages, and learn and analyze based on a large amount of language data, so as to better understand and express the meaning of language. this technology plays an increasingly important role in daily life, for example: helping people communicate between different languages ​​and promoting cross-cultural communication; providing fast and convenient translation services to facilitate users to obtain the information they need; assisting authors in text translation and improving creative efficiency; and even helping search engines understand and retrieve content in different languages.
